About Canadian Dollar (CAD)

The Canadian Dollar (CAD) is the official currency issued by the central bank. It plays a vital role in the global economy and international trade. The exchange rate of Canadian Dollar against major currencies like USD, EUR, and CNY is closely watched by forex traders worldwide. Factors affecting the CAD exchange rate include interest rate decisions, inflation data, and GDP growth.

About Brazilian Real (BRL)

The Brazilian Real (BRL) is the legal tender. Its exchange rate is influenced by various economic factors including monetary policy, trade balance, and market sentiment. The BRL/CAD exchange rate is important for businesses engaged in international trade and cross-border investments.

CAD/BRL Exchange Rate Trends & Analysis

The CAD/BRL exchange rate fluctuates based on supply and demand in the foreign exchange market. Key economic indicators such as interest rate differentials, inflation reports, and employment data can significantly impact this currency pair's movement.
